Roche Grande
Roche Grande is a mountain in Allanche, Arrondissement of Saint-Flour,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es and has an elevation of 1,151 metres. Roche Grande is situated nearby to the hamlet Romaniargues, as well as near the locality Vernols.| Tap on a place to explore it |
